• 2022-06-11
    一个对称矩阵A[1..10,1..10]采用压缩存储方式,将其下三角部分按行优先存储到一维数组B[0..m]中,则A[8][5]元素在B中的位置k是()。
    A: 32
    B: 37
    C: 45
    D: 60
  • A

    举一反三

    内容

    • 0

      设有一个10×10的堆成矩阵A[10][10],采取按行压缩存储的方式存放于一个一维数组B[ ]中,则数组B[ ]的容量应为______。若设A[0][0]存放于B[0],且数组A[ ][ ]的每一个数组元素在数组B[ ]中占一个数组元素位置,若按照下三角方式压缩仔放,A[8][5]在数组B[ ]中的位置是______;按照上i角方式压缩存放,A[8][5]在数组B( )中的位置是______。 A: 41 B: 43 C: 49 D: 65

    • 1

      对称矩阵A[0..9][0..9]采用压缩存储方式,将其上三角部分(含主对角元素)按行优先存储到一维数组B[m]中,B中的下标从0开始,则矩阵元素A[6][1]在数组B中的下标k是( )。 A: 15 B: 16 C: 17 D: 18

    • 2

      中国大学MOOC: 一个n阶对称矩阵A&#91;1..n,1..n&#93;采用压缩存储方式,将其下三角部分按行优先存储到一维数组B&#91;1..m&#93;中,则A[i]&#91;j&#93;(i<j)元素在B中的位置k是( )。[/i]

    • 3

      一个10阶下三角矩阵A&#91;0..9,0..9&#93;按行优先压缩存放在一维数组B&#91;0..m&#93;中,则A&#91;3&#93;&#91;2&#93;在B中的位置k是( )。 A: 1 B: 8 C: 10 D: 21

    • 4

      ​将4×6的二维数组A按照行优先顺序存储到一维数组B中,则B&#91;0&#93;中存储的二维数组元素是A&#91;0&#93;&#91;__&#93;。‏